PSG's Vitinha Hat-Trick Sinks Tottenham: A Battling Display from Spurs

Tottenham faced another defeat as Paris St Germain's Vitinha scored a hat-trick in a 5-3 loss. Despite taking the lead twice through Richarlison and Randal Kolo Muani, Spurs couldn't hold on. The team, led by Thomas Frank, showed resilience after their recent loss to Arsenal. Frank fielded a younger squad in Paris, with players like Archie Gray, Lucas Bergvall, and Pape Sarr getting the nod.
Bergvall and Gray had promising moments early on, but PSG's Marquinhos intercepted Gray's center. Despite some close chances, Tottenham managed to take the lead in the 35th minute with Richarlison's close-range header. However, Vitinha equalized with a thunderous strike from distance just before halftime. Tottenham regained the lead early in the second half through Kolo Muani's goal, but PSG responded with three quick goals.
Vitinha scored his second to level the score, followed by Ruiz's goal to put PSG ahead. Pacho added another goal for the hosts before Kolo Muani scored his second to keep Tottenham in the game. However, Vitinha completed his hat-trick from the penalty spot, sealing the win for PSG. Despite the loss, Tottenham showed attacking intent, with Kolo Muani impressing against his parent club.
